Following the attacks on the twin towers, the entire American community began to abhor people that had a different skin colour and were averse to the idea of letting opposite religions, especially Islam, persist within their country. However, they needed to remember that not everyone that practised Islam was a part of the terrorist attacks. A number of people that had been kil guide had been Islamic too. Americans shed hatred towards other cultures for a long time following the attacks and burnt-out down a temple as well. One sikh man, mistaken to be a Muslim, was even shot and killed by American haters. All this led to a very gory separation among the people as trust was betrayed and people began to flee to their homes in order to stay safe. All over the world, borders unkindly temporarily as people did not want to accept anyone belonging to different cultures into their countries for some time. Most people were even afraid to sit on flights because they feared that they would be hijacked. However, at the time it was important to understand that the attacks had already taken place and not much could be done about it. There were memorials and vigils held in memory of those that had died in the tower crashes. Since March 2002, the Tribute in Light had been set up on Ground Zero, which were beacons of light arranged in the said(prenominal) squares as the twin towers, that shone in the night in order to complete the skyline. A number of books and publications were released following the attacks, by writers in Germany, France as well as America, condemning the fact that the 9/11 attacks were not only Al-Qa eda related. These writers stated that there were a number of combination theories which involved involvement from the Israeli as well as the American government itself. A number of people began to question the politics that George Bush was headspring at the time. Several movies depicting the crash were also released and cried, raged, sang and remembered alike. A number of fund raisers were held by musicians and pop stars in order to give cover charge money to the families of those affected. However, what was surprising was that the US went to war dropping bombs on Afghanistan just a month after all the commotion had taken place. (Lehrer, Jimmy) In recent times, in May 2011 itself, it was reported that Osama Bin Laden was captured and killed by American militants and that the world need not fear his plans anyto a greater extent. It must be understood that more than half the Islamic community as well as other people around the world were as overjoyed about the capture as Americans because they too wanted justice to prevail.
